Celebrations in Assam as Murmu set to become first tribal woman President of India

Guwahati, July 21: As the ballots started hinting toward a victory for National Democratic Alliance (NDA)-backed Presidential candidate Droupadi Murmu, celebrations began across the country and in Assam massive celebrations have started.

The main celebration rally was held in Guwahati where about 10,000 BJP supporters came and it was led by Assam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ma.

In Murmu’s native village of Rairangpur in Odisha, anticipating her victory, the villagers made sweets and were getting ready for celebrations on Wednesday. Villagers have also planned a victory procession and tribal dance on Thursday.

The BJP has also planned grand celebrations in Murmu’s home state. Local BJP leader Tapan Mahanta said that preparations are underway for preparing 20,000 laddus and putting up 100 banners congratulating Murmu.
